The Team
The SAP Central Infrastructure Operations team, a unit of Global Cloud Services, is looking for leadership in the area of Change Management. You will be responsible for executing against a transformation vision to improve change management initiatives to yield better outcomes.
The Role
In this role you will:
Act as the lead coordinator of problem management activity for central infrastructure operations.
Supply a structured and methodical approach to problem management
Provide and present to periodic reports and presentations.
Interact with various levels of management and stakeholders
Adopt a culture of continual process improvement and best practice within region, with regional peers in global forums, to ensure processes and tools are effective
Ability to track tasks, make assignments, effectively delegate and deliver on commitment dates.
Working with other Networking leadership, assess and improve problem management efforts and maturity to increase availability, stability and performance, and throughput of changes.
Regularly review problem management plans to raise the bar for execution success and excellence.
Provide regular feedback in to process definition in dedication to continuous improvement.
Manage mutually trusted relationships with stakeholders to achieve jointly defined goals and improve customer perceptions and satisfaction
Provide leadership and direction to team members, supporting the alignment of individual goals and career objectives with team direction.
Act as a single point of contact for one or more Problems.
Identify, record, classify, investigate and diagnose IT Environment Problems.
Identifies trends and potential Problem sources (by reviewing Incident and Problem analysis)
Create and update Problem Records and schedule regular Problem Management meetings to track error resolution tasks.

The Role Requirements
10 years experience related to Service Delivery within an IT environment.
Focus on operational excellence with a background in areas like Service Delivery, Problem Management, Configuration Management, Risk Management, Incident and Change Management governance, Infrastructure Lifecycle management, IT project management
Certifications in ITIL v3 or v4 or Lean Six Sigma are preferred
Excellent coordination and facilitation skills are required, certifications in PMP or Prince2 are a plus.
Excellent process execution and administration
Strong root cause analysis, problem solving, and analytical skills
Ability to assess past failures and improve upon plans to avoid repeated errors.
Track record of success
Problem solving experience across all functional layers with an emphasis on quick problem resolution
Able to work independently, while keeping stakeholders informed, delegate where necessary and motivate cross functional teams.
Superior written and verbal communication skills and ability to communicate with colleagues of all levels in a clear concise manner; both verbal and written.
We are SAP
SAP innovations help more than 400,000 customers worldwide work together more efficiently and use business insight more effectively. Originally known for leadership in en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, SAP has evolved to become a market leader in end-to-end business application software and related services for database, analytics, intelligent technologies, and experience management. As a cloud company with 200 million users and more than 100,000 employees worldwide, we are purpose-driven and future-focused, with a highly collaborative team ethic and commitment to personal development.
